Output 53f24ae3faeb40b72ce40d8ba04192aad57969c66e63a99734f6daec9b265212:1

value
132886388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ff4ee2522ba891b3903ab894f0cc0c27ea5798a OP_EQUAL
address
MJ78emwwX1KsRYhnTwfpgyTgDTx2V5yodu
transaction
53f24ae3faeb40b72ce40d8ba04192aad57969c66e63a99734f6daec9b265212
spent
true